Catholics to gather at Parish Convening
Hundreds of Catholics from the Albany Diocese will gather at LaSalle Institute in Troy on Oct. 30 for the 2004 Parish Convening, a day of prayer, learning and reflection.
The theme is "Go...Share the Good News." The keynoter is Carole Eipers, executive director of catechetics for William H. Sadlier, Inc.
On this page, three of the workshops are previewed, but there are dozens of others on such topics as liturgical music, the Cathedral of the Immaculate Conception in Albany, Scripture, family life, evangelization, bereavement ministry, Catholic schools and storytelling.
Registrations are due by Oct. 20. Call 453-6661 for information, or visit www.rcda.org and follow the links under "calendar of events." The cost is $18/person.
